In the Microsoft Sustainability Manager, emission factors can be mapped to reference data entities such as products. Additionally, a product hierarchy can be defined using Product Categories.
Currently, if a specific product does not have an associated emission factor, the system throws an error and no emissions are calculated. This can be problematic in cases where granular emission factor data is not available for all product levels.
Proposed Enhancement:
Implement fallback logic that supports hierarchical resolution in reference data mapping. If no emission factor is found for a specific product, the system should automatically check higher levels in the product hierarchy until a matching emission factor is found.
Business Value:
- Prevents calculation failures due to missing product-level emission factors
- Improves data coverage and robustness of sustainability reporting
- Supports more flexible and scalable modeling of product emissions, especially in complex supply chains with partial factor availability